Cryptosporidiosis


Cryptosporidiosis in Washington State
Since cryptosporidiois became reportable in Washington in 2000, the number of reported cases has increased from 65 in 2000 to 139 in 2007.  Outbreaks of cryptosporidiosis in Washington have been associated with small commercial water systems and wells. 

Purpose of Reporting and Surveillance

  • To identify sources of major public health concern (e.g., a public water supply or swimming pool) and to stop further transmission.
  • To identify whether the case may be a source of infection for other persons (e.g., a child care attendee or food handler), and if so, to prevent further transmission.  

Legal Reporting Requirements

  • Health care providers: notifiable to Local Health Jurisdiction within 3 work days
  • Hospitals: notifiable to Local Health Jurisdiction within 3 work days
  • Laboratories: notifiable to Local Health Jurisdiction within 2 work days
  • Local health jurisdictions: notifiable to DOH Communicable Disease Epidemiology within 7 days of case investigation completion or summary information required within 21 days
